The energy efficiency of this apartment is excellent, as evidenced by the A+++ energy label. This is the highest possible energy rating in the Netherlands. The apartment features HR++ glass, full wall insulation, and floor heating throughout the entire living space. Heating and hot water are provided through district heating (stadsverwarming), which is an efficient and sustainable heating solution. These features contribute to lower energy costs and a comfortable indoor climate throughout the year.

The property is part of a larger residential project, and as such, buyers become members of the Homeowners Association (Vereniging van Eigenaren, VvE) upon purchase. The monthly VvE contribution is approximately 205.77 euros. This contribution covers several costs including the building insurance, reserves for major and minor maintenance, cleaning costs including window cleaning, and electricity consumption in the common areas.
According to the VvE checklist provided in the listing, the association is registered with the Chamber of Commerce (KvK). There is an active maintenance plan in place, and the building insurance is arranged through the VvE. However, the checklist indicates that there is no separate reserve fund and that annual general meetings are not held, which is noteworthy for potential buyers to consider.
